Water Damage Mitigation v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small water leak in a bathroom Yes No You can fix it yourself with some basic plumbing tools.
Large water leak in a basement No Yes The water damage can be extensive and need specialized equipment to dry and clean.
Water damage to a small area of carpet Yes No You can clean and dry the carpet yourself with some basic cleaning products.
Water damage to a large area of drywall No Yes The water damage can be extensive and need specialized equipment to dry and clean.
Musty odors in a home with no signs of water damage No Yes The odors could be a sign of hidden water damage that needs professional attention.

Water Damage Mitigation Cost In Riddleville, GA

The cost of Water Damage Mitigation can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Riddleville, GA. Here are some estimated price ranges for different aspects of the service: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ction $500 – $2,500 The size of the affected area and the amount of water extracted.
Drying and Dehumidification $1,000 – $5,000 The size of the affected area and the amount of equipment needed.
Sanitizing and Cleaning $500 – $2,000 The extent of the contamination and the specialized equipment needed.
Reconstruction and Repair $2,000 – $10,000 The extent of the damage and the materials needed for repairs.
More Services (Mold Remediation, etc.) $1,000 – $5,000 The type and extent of the more services needed.

Q: Can I prevent water damage from happening in the first place?

A: Yes! By taking a few simple precautions, you can reduce the risk of water damage in your home. These include checking your roof and gutters regularly, inspecting your plumbing and appliances, and ensuring that your home’s foundation is secure.
